Transaction 12effa01fcdbbe9ce301001237aa651f5e15f78a9e2524f9062eb1baac690454
1 Input
1 Output
-
12effa01fcdbbe9ce301001237aa651f5e15f78a9e2524f9062eb1baac690454:0
- value
- 71347891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 124151c8e563ad6058fa02191cd8c33ca6dd7d6b OP_EQUAL
- address
- 33MYLUPxa3V5mH4TVewwDfoSUiQ7R8qD4P